Qantas has posted a $1.9 billion underlying loss for the full 2022 financial year.

Qantas loss halves as revenue jumps 54pc on border reopening travel surgeQantas roughly halves its full-year loss to $860 million, as revenue jumps 54 per cent from 2021, when state and international border closures affected air travel more severely. Qantas reports $1.9b loss, plots $400m buybackQantas has reported a $1.9 billion underlying loss in the year to June 30, its third huge loss in a row as its recovery from COVID-19 continues before the airline finally expects to return to profitability in the next financial year.
